计算机应用主要设计到哪些方面,大学计算机应用基础教案设计.doc

大学计算机应用基础教案

教 师: 腾莉

单 位: 数学计算机学院

2009 ~ 2010学年

第一讲 计算机基础知识概述

【教学目的】

了解计算机概念、特点、发展历程、类型应用领域等基本知识计算机基本概念和分类计算机一、计算机的概念

计算机(computer)是一种能自动、高速进行大量算术运算和逻辑运算的电子设备。 速度快、精度高、存储容量大、通用性强、具有逻辑判断和自动控制能力。计算机的发展简史

第一台计算机:ENIAC,美国,1946年。ENIAC是为了解决新武器研发中有关弹道问题的许多复杂计算而研制的。它采用电子管作为计算机的基本元件,由18000多个电子管,1500多个继电器,10000多只电容器和7000多只电阻构成,占地170m2,重量30吨,每小时耗电30万千瓦每秒能进行5000次加法运算。由于它使用电子器件来代替机械齿轮或电动机械进行运算,并且能在运算过程中不断进行判断,选择,过去需要100多名工程师花费1年才能解决的计算问题,它只需要2个小时就能给出答案。

第一代(1946年~1958年)电子管计算机第二代(1959年~1964年)晶体管计算机

第三代(1965年~1970年)集成电路计算机

第四代(1971年以后)大规模集成电路计算机主要特点如下:运算速度快、精确度高、具有记忆和逻辑判断能力科学计算:天气预报、地震分析、导弹拦截等?

数据处理(信息处理):数据库、企业管理、办公自动化?

计算机控制(实时控制):飞行控制、加工控制、生产线控制、交通指示灯控制等

计算机辅助设计和辅助教学:辅助工程?、辅助设计(CAD)、辅助制造(CAM)、辅助教学(CAI)等

人工智能方面的研究和应用

多媒体技术应用、嵌入式应用、网络应用等

1、观察并比较第一台计算机图片和笔记本电脑图片,从中看出计算机的发展。你的感受是什么?从体积、运算能力、操作难易等角度分析比较。

2、网上查找资料:我国巨型机情况;运算速度是多少?我国自行研制的巨型机称为什么系列?掌握信息的表示和存储;掌握存储容量的单位;掌握数制之间的转换,特别是二进制与十进制之间;了解ASCII码

【教学重点】

掌握存储容量;进制之间数据转换二进制与十进制之间数据转换数制是用一组固定的数字和一套统一的规则来表示数目的方法。

二进制、十进制、八进制、十六进制一般我们用( ) 角标表示不同进制的数。例如:十进制用( )10表示,二进制数用( )2表示。R进制即是有R个基本符号,逢R进一。 例二进制基本符号有二个,为0、1;十进制基本符号有十个,为0、1、2、3、4、5、6、7、8、9日常生活中最常用的数制是十进制。计算机数据是二进制形式。

基数:一组固定不变的不重复数字的个数。例如:二进制数基数是2,十进制数基数为10位权:某个位置上的数代表的数量大小。表示此数在整个数中所占的权重。

按权展开后,相加即得。例: (101.11)2= 1×22 + 0×21 + 1× 20 + 1× 2-1 + 1× 2-2

(101.11)8= 1×82 + 0×81 + 1× 80 + 1× 8-1 + 1× 8-2

(101.11)16= 1×162 + 0×161 + 1× 160 + 1× 16-1 + 1× 16-2

2、十进制转换为二进制、八进制、十六进制

方法:除2(8或16),取余数。

例:(43)10=(101011)2

二进制,八进制,十六进制数的相互转换

1)二进制数转换成八进制数

方法:“三合一”,用三位二进制表示一位

2)二进制数转换为十六进制数

方法:“四合一”,用四位二进制表示一位

3)八进制数转换成二进制数

方法:“一拉三”,把一位八进制用三位二进制表示

4)十六进制数转换成二进制数

方法:“一拉四”,把一位十六进制用四位二进制表示

信息存储单位

1、计算机中数据的存储单位

1)位 (bit) 缩写为b ,指的是二进制数的一位,又称比特,是计算机存储数据的最小单位。

2字节 (byte) 缩写为B,一个字节由8位二进制数组成(1B=8b)

在计算机中,通常用B(字节)、KB(千字节)、MB(兆字节)或GB(吉字节)为单位来表示存储器的存储容量或文件的大小。

2存储单位B、KB、MB与GB的换算关系

1B=8bit (20B) 1KB=1024B (210B)

1MB=1024KB (220B) 1GB=1024MB (230B)

1TB=1024GB (240

深度学习是机器学习的一个子领域,它基于人工神经网络的研究,特别是利用多层次的神经网络来进行学习和模式识别。深度学习模型能够学习数据的高层次特征,这些特征对于图像和语音识别、自然语言处理、医学图像分析等应用至关重要。以下是深度学习的一些关键概念和组成部分: 1. **神经网络(Neural Networks)**:深度学习的基础是人工神经网络,它是由多个层组成的网络结构,包括输入层、隐藏层和输出层。每个层由多个神经元组成,神经元之间通过权重连接。 2. **前馈神经网络(Feedforward Neural Networks)**:这是最常见的神经网络类型,信息从输入层流向隐藏层,最终到达输出层。 3. **卷积神经网络(Convolutional Neural Networks, CNNs)**:这种网络特别适合处理具有网格结构的数据,如图像。它们使用卷积层来提取图像的特征。 4. **循环神经网络(Recurrent Neural Networks, RNNs)**:这种网络能够处理序列数据,如时间序列或自然语言,因为它们具有记忆功能,能够捕捉数据中的时间依赖性。 5. **长短期记忆网络(Long Short-Term Memory, LSTM)**:LSTM 是一种特殊的 RNN,它能够学习长期依赖关系,非常适合复杂的序列预测任务。 6. **生成对抗网络(Generative Adversarial Networks, GANs)**:由两个网络组成,一个生成器和一个判别器,它们相互竞争,生成器生成数据,判别器评估数据的真实性。 7. **深度学习框架**:如 TensorFlow、Keras、PyTorch 等,这些框架提供了构建、训练和部署深度学习模型的工具和库。 8. **激活函数(Activation Functions)**:如 ReLU、Sigmoid、Tanh 等,它们在神经网络中用于添加非线性,使得网络能够学习复杂的函数。 9. **损失函数(Loss Functions)**:用于评估模型的预测与真实值之间的差异,常见的损失函数包括均方误差(MSE)、交叉熵(Cross-Entropy)等。 10. **优化算法(Optimization Algorithms)**:如梯度下降(Gradient Descent)、随机梯度下降(SGD)、Adam 等,用于更新网络权重,以最小化损失函数。 11. **正则化(Regularization)**:技术如 Dropout、L1/L2 正则化等,用于防止模型过拟合。 12. **迁移学习(Transfer Learning)**:利用在一个任务上训练好的模型来提高另一个相关任务的性能。 深度学习在许多领域都取得了显著的成就,但它也面临着一些挑战,如对大量数据的依赖、模型的解释性差、计算资源消耗大等。研究人员正在不断探索新的方法来解决这些问题。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值